국문 초록
To make a new analytic program of evaluation for fire resistance, the backbone of building laws and the technical references related to fire engineering design method were surveyed and the mechanical and thermal data were gathered from the previous experimental data. The analytic program was developed by using the excel utilities and designed 3 major parts; input, solving and output. To verify the developed analytic program the comparison was done by using the previous fire test with standard sized-scale column built with a SS 400. The comparison showed that the increasing of temperature and deformation with time were very similar between analytic results and fire test. But the rapid increase of deformation according to expansion and local buckling caused from higher temperature couldn't be calculated.
